Background of the Study
ATM security protocols are critical in protecting customer funds and reducing fraud in the banking sector. Guaranty Trust Bank (GTBank) has implemented a range of advanced security measures in its ATM network to mitigate fraud risks. Between 2023 and 2025, GTBank has upgraded its ATM systems with features such as biometric authentication, end-to-end encryption, and real-time transaction monitoring. These protocols are designed to detect and prevent unauthorized access and fraudulent activities, thereby safeguarding both the bank’s assets and customer trust.

The evolution of digital banking has necessitated continuous improvements in ATM security. With the increasing frequency and sophistication of cyber-attacks, robust security protocols are essential to counter emerging threats. GTBank’s strategy involves not only technological upgrades but also regular staff training and customer awareness campaigns to ensure that security measures are effectively utilized. The bank’s commitment to security is reflected in its investment in cutting-edge technologies and its proactive approach to addressing vulnerabilities. These efforts have resulted in a noticeable reduction in fraud incidents, contributing to improved operational stability and enhanced customer confidence (Okeke, 2024).

However, challenges persist. The integration of new security technologies with existing ATM infrastructure can lead to compatibility issues, and occasional system downtimes may create vulnerabilities that fraudsters can exploit. Additionally, the dynamic nature of fraud necessitates that security protocols be continuously updated, which can be resource-intensive. This study will investigate the effectiveness of GTBank’s ATM security protocols in reducing fraud, analyzing quantitative data on fraud incidence and qualitative feedback from bank security personnel. The aim is to determine the extent to which current protocols meet security objectives and to propose recommendations for further improvements.

Statement of the Problem :
Despite significant investments in ATM security enhancements, GTBank continues to experience challenges in fully mitigating fraud. Instances of ATM fraud, although reduced, still occur, suggesting that the current security protocols may have vulnerabilities. Integration issues between new security features and legacy systems have resulted in sporadic system failures, during which ATMs are more susceptible to fraud. Additionally, while advanced technologies such as biometric authentication and encryption have improved security, their effectiveness is sometimes compromised by operational errors or insufficient maintenance. Customers have reported instances of delayed response times when fraudulent activities are detected, which can undermine trust in the ATM network.

Furthermore, rapid technological changes and evolving fraud tactics require continuous updates to security measures. The bank’s current protocols may not be sufficiently agile to adapt to new threats, leading to periods of increased risk. These challenges are compounded by the need for comprehensive staff training and robust monitoring systems, which are not uniformly implemented across all ATM locations. Consequently, the potential of ATM security protocols to fully reduce fraud is not being realized, impacting both customer confidence and the bank’s reputation. This study seeks to examine these enforcement gaps and operational challenges, aiming to provide actionable recommendations for enhancing ATM security protocols, reducing fraud incidence, and strengthening overall system resilience.
